The poster reports the results of hydrogeological studies on the Surface-based Investigation (Phase I) at the Mizunami Underground Laboratory Project. The hydrogeological studies have been carried out in order to understand (1) groundwater flow characteristics, (2) dilution of nuclides, (3) volume of inflow into underground tunnels, and (4) impact induced by construction of underground tunnels on water table and hydraulic pressure. The poster compiles the main results to be understood these items, and technical findings and know-how which can serve as foundation to disposal business.

MT survey has been applied to various fields in recent years. It is recognized as an effective method for identifying deep resistivity structures in the crust. However, it is difficult to acquire high quality data in highly noisy environments because natural electromagnetic fields are used in the MT survey. To apply MT survey in such environments, it is important to develop a robust stacking method to improve the quality of the MT spectrum data. At the last SEGJ conference held in Spring 2007, we have reported a new effective and robust stacking method based on MT reliability index (Negi et al., 2005). In this study, we report the development of the robust smoothing method for MT data to be with the robust stacking method for EDI files. Applied to poor quality data, it improved the data to interpretable data in a short time. Therefore, it is expected to be effective and practical method for improving poor quality data.
